Spaz - N.E.R.D

"Spaz" by N.E.R.D is a high-energy, funk-infused hip-hop track that was released in 2008. The song's theme revolves around self-expression, confidence, and embracing one's individuality. The lyrics speak to breaking free from societal norms and expectations, encouraging listeners to let loose and be themselves. The composition of "Spaz" features a catchy, upbeat instrumental that combines elements of rock, hip-hop, and electronic music. The infectious guitar riffs, pulsating bassline, and energetic drum patterns create a dynamic and lively sound that is sure to get listeners moving. One notable aspect of the song is the use of distorted vocals and playful ad-libs, adding a sense of spontaneity and fun to the track. The chorus is catchy and anthemic, with Pharrell Williams delivering a spirited performance that perfectly captures the rebellious and carefree spirit of the song. Overall, "Spaz" is a feel-good, party-ready anthem that celebrates individuality and unapologetic self-expression. Its infectious energy and memorable hooks make it a standout track in N.E.R.D's discography, showcasing the group's unique blend of genres and their ability to create music that is both fun and thought-provoking.

N.E.R.D

N.E.R.D, short for No One Ever Really Dies, is an American rock and hip-hop group formed in 1999. The group consists of Pharrell Williams, Chad Hugo, and Shay Haley. Pharrell Williams and Chad Hugo first met in high school and bonded over their shared love of music. They both had a passion for producing and songwriting, which led them to form the production duo The Neptunes. They quickly gained recognition for their innovative production style, blending elements of hip-hop, R&B, and pop. In 1999, they teamed up with Shay Haley to form N.E.R.D, a side project that allowed them to explore a more eclectic and experimental sound. The group released their debut album, "In Search Of..." in 2002, which received critical acclaim for its genre-blurring style and socially conscious lyrics. N.E.R.D's music is known for its fusion of rock, hip-hop, funk, and electronic music, creating a sound that is uniquely their own. They have been praised for their bold experimentation and willingness to push the boundaries of traditional music genres. Over the years, N.E.R.D has released several successful albums, including "Fly or Die" in 2004 and "Seeing Sounds" in 2008. They have collaborated with a diverse range of artists, including Jay-Z, Kanye West, and Rihanna. N.E.R.D's impact on music is significant, as they have inspired a new generation of artists to take risks and push the boundaries of what is considered mainstream. They have been credited with helping to popularize the fusion of rock and hip-hop, paving the way for a more diverse and inclusive music industry. In addition to their music, N.E.R.D is also known for their activism and social commentary. They have used their platform to speak out against injustice and inequality, addressing issues such as police brutality and systemic racism. Overall, N.E.R.D is a groundbreaking and influential group that has left a lasting impact on the music industry. Their innovative sound and socially conscious lyrics continue to inspire and resonate with fans around the world.
